Abstract:BACKGROUND – Colombia occupies 4th place among all Latin American countries in HIV/AIDS incidence rates, which have been increasing since the 1980s. There is a paucity of studies which address this trend. In this study we employed spatial and temporal trend analyses to study how the epidemic behaves in Colombian territory. METHODS - Our sample was composed of 72,994 HIV/AIDS cases and 21,898 AIDS-related deaths reported to the National Ministry of Health between 2008 and 2016.
